BirthAssumed*He is assumed to have been born circa 14 August 1827 probably in Kayl, Esch-sur-Alzette, Luxembourg, Luxembourg.1,2 
Marriage*Michael married Mary Barthel, daughter of John Barthel, circa 1855 in Paris, France.2,3 
Census 1870*Michael was listed as the head of a family on the 1870 Census in Liberty Township, Seneca County, Ohio, Michael and Mary farmed in Liberty township with their family. All of the children were still in school.4 
Census 1880*Michael was listed as the head of a family on the 1880 Census in Liberty Township, Seneca County, Ohio. The official date of this census was 1 Jun 1880. Also living in the household were his wife, Mary Karper (given age 41), his sons, Frederick Karper (given age 23), Albert Karper (given age 22), Jacob Karper (given age 20), Joseph Karper (given age 16), Henry Karper (given age 12), John Karper (given age 10), Gabrael Karper (given age 9), Franklin Karper (given age 6) and George Karper (given age 4), his daughter, Annie Karper (given age 15)., his daughter-in-law, Maggie Karper (given age 19) Michael and his newly-married son, Frederick, ran the family farm in Liberty township with the help of the other sons. Daughters Helen, Margaret and Mary were married and left the household.5 
Death*Michael died on 22 July 1885 in Liberty Township, Seneca County, Ohio.1 
Burial*He was buried in St. Andrew's Cemetery, located in Liberty Township, Seneca County, Ohio.1

Obit-Text*
Death Follows Long Illness

     Mrs. Mary Koerper, aged 88 years, widow of Michael Koerper, died at the home of her son, Jacob Koerper, 135 Jefferson street, Saturday 11 p. m. of infirmities incidental to her advanced years. She had been a semi-invalid during the last 25 years and during the last 13 weeks had been confined to her bed.
     The deceased was born in Kael, Luxemburg, Germany, December 23, 1829. She was a daughter of Mr. and Mrs. John Bartell. In her young womanhood she went to Paris, France, where she was married to Mr. Koerper. Her two eldest sons were born in that city. In 1856, the family emigrated to this country and settled in Seneca county. For many years she was a resident of Big Spring township, where her husband died about 30 years ago. Mrs. Koerper had resided with her son here during the last three years.
     The deceased was the mother of 13 children, nine sons and four daughters. Seven sons and four daughters survive. Two sons, Albert and George, were killed in railroad accidents, the former about 30 years ago on the Pennsylvania when a quantity of earth fell on him from a railroad bank, and the latter on the Toldeo and Ohio Central some years later.
     The surviving sons and daughters are Fred, Pierre City, Mo; Jacob, of this city; Henry, Liberty township; John, Chicago, Ill; Joseph, residence unknown; Frank, Sedalia, Mo; Gabriel, Detroit, Mich; Mrs. Helen Smith and Mrs. William Groenwold, of this city; Mrs. Peter Altweis, Toledo; and Mrs. Andrew Brickner, Jackson township.
     Funeral at St. Joseph's church Tuesday, 8:30 a. m; burial in the parish cemetery.
